Suivez-nous sur X

|
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z,
ALL
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z
|
|
0,
A,
B,
C,
D,
E,
F,
G,
H,
I,
J,
K,
L,
M,
N,
O,
P,
Q,
R,
S,
T,
U,
V,
W,
X,
Y,
Z
|
|
A propos d'Obligement
|
|
David Brunet
|
|
|
|
En pratique : Les petits utilitaires de XPK
(Article écrit par Sébastien Vendroux - mars 1999)
|
|
On est reparti pour les fabuleuses aventures d'XPK et compagnie. Cette
fois, nous allons faire un petit tour des outils utiles du paquetage XPK. En
route.
Qu'est-ce donc ?!
Les petits utilitaires d'XPK sont des programmes qui s'utilisent dans un
Shell et qui permettent d'effectuer des opérations spécifiques sur un ou des
fichiers compactés en XPK. Ces programmes doivent donc être copiés dans le
répertoire C. Pour ceux qui découvrent XPK, ces commandes sont disponibles
au sein du paquetage XPK_User.lha.
La commande Xdir
Usage : Xdir <fichier/répertoire>
Elle joue le même rôle que la commande DIR d'AmigaOS à défaut que
celle-ci donne des informations sur le/les fichier(s) mis en argument.
Xdir indique la taille du fichier original, celle du fichier compacté,
l'efficacité de compression, le type de compresseur utilisé (ex: SQSH), les
bits de protection (ex: ----rwed) et bien sûr le nom du fichier. Dans le
cas d'un répertoire, il totalise la taille originale de tous les fichiers puis
leur taille compacté et donne l'efficacité totale de la compression sur tout
le répertoire. Exemple : "Xdir DH2:ModsXpk".
La commande Xtype
Usage : Xtype <fichier>
Affiche le contenu ASCII du fichier (compacté ou non).
Exemple : Xtype Data:Docs/MaugDog/NoticeEntretien.xpk
La commande Xscan
Usage : Xscan <fichier/répertoire/répertoire+motif> (ALL) (REMOVE)
Exemple de motif : #?.xpk c'est-à-dire tous les fichiers en .xpk
Si vous suivez les articles d'XPK depuis le début, vous avez certainement dû
faire une partition XFH, et vous avez aussi remarqué que la lecture d'un
répertoire sous XFH est affreusement lente (même avec un 68060).
Voici un remède miracle au problème. Xscan annote les fichiers un par un
selon qu'il soit compacté ou pas. Cela permet une accélération notable de
la lecture du répertoire.
L'argument "ALL" permet d'annoter les fichiers se trouvant dans les sous-répertoires
du répertoire à traiter. L'argument "REMOVE" permet d'effectuer
l'opération inverse de Xscan. Il retire toutes les annotations du ou des
fichiers à traiter. Exemple : Xscan DH1:ModsXpk ALL
La commande Xup
Usage : Xup (-s) (-p <mot de passe>) <fichiers>
Cet utilitaire est fort utile puisqu'il permet de décompacter un fichier
XPK (bien que l'usage d'Xpkatana soit plus simple). Il décompacte le ou les
fichiers à traiter et effacent les originaux (compressés). Lorsque que
l'argument "-s" est présent, l'original est préservé. Quant à l'argument "-p",
il sert simplement à entrer le mot de passe nécessaire à la décompression
d'un fichier crypté.
Le mot de la fin
Je pense avoir fait le tour de la question XPK. Mais, si par hasard il
était nécessaire d'en reparler, écrivez-moi à l'adresse du magazine. J'espère
vous avoir fait apprécier l'univers pittoresque de XPK.
|